Message type: E = Error
Message class: GTCN_MESSAGE - GTCN: Message Class
Message number: 373
Message text: Saving empty refund list is not allowed

- Saving empty refund list is not allowed ?The SAP error message GTCN_MESSAGE373 ("Saving empty refund list is not allowed") typically occurs in the context of the SAP system when a user attempts to save a refund list that does not contain any entries. This error is part of the SAP Global Trade Services (GTS) module, which is used for managing compliance and trade processes.

To resolve this error, you should ensure that the refund list contains at least one valid entry before attempting to save it. Here are the steps you can take:
Check the Refund List: Review the refund list to confirm that it contains entries. If it is empty, you will need to add the necessary refund items.
Add Refund Items: If the list is empty, go back to the previous screen or transaction where you can add refund items. Ensure that you select the appropriate items that need to be refunded.
Validate Entries: Make sure that the entries you are adding are valid and meet the criteria for refunds in your organization’s processes.
Save Again: Once you have added the necessary items to the refund list, try saving it again.
Check for System Issues: If you believe that the list should contain entries but it appears empty, check for any system issues or errors that may have occurred during the process of adding items.
By ensuring that the refund list is populated with valid entries, you should be able to avoid the GTCN_MESSAGE373 error and successfully save your refund list.
